The High Line
Elevated walkway blends nature and cityscape with art installations and green spaces along a peaceful, quiet path. Visitors find plentiful seating to enjoy views of skyscrapers and urban architecture without city noise. The atmosphere balances industrial vibe with relaxing, scenic strolls.
Good to know
Access to the High Line is free.
The High Line is a 1.45 mile long public park in Manhattan's West Side.
A free 45-minute performance called 'A Leaf's Pilgrimage' happens regularly.

Brooklyn Museum
Imposing neoclassical building with a modern glass entrance creates a grand and welcoming space filled with natural light. Atmosphere stays relaxed and intimate, inviting quiet art appreciation amid spacious galleries and visible storage showcasing behind-the-scenes art. African music and live bands add a distinctive cultural layer to the experience.
Good to know
First Saturday events occur monthly with live music and pop-up activities.
The Thierry Mugler exhibit is available until May 2023.
Admission is pay-what-you-wish, but online reservations are recommended.
